What You'll Do:



  • Program, set up, and operate CNC machines using drawings, processors, and programming tools
  • Build sub-routines that account for geometry and tolerances to ensure accurate production
  • Manually program and run Bridgeport-type machines from blueprints
  • Select tooling, review programs, and make edits to keep production on spec
  • Maintain tight tolerances based on part drawings
  • Handle secondary operations such as deburring when needed
  • Support and guide lower-level operators on proper machine use
  • Keep production records updated and maintain a clean, safe work area
  • Follow all safety guidelines and report equipment or material issues



What We're Looking For:



  • At least 5 years of CNC and Bridgeport-type machine operation
  • Comfortable measuring with calipers, micrometers, and height gauges
  • Experience with CNC programming is a plus
  • Someone who takes pride in producing accurate, high-quality parts
  • Comfortable working in a busy environment with shifting priorities
  • Able to work overtime as needed, including evenings or weekends
  • A team-oriented mindset with the ability to work well with all levels
